What Does an MRI Technologist Do?
This position combines technical precision with compassionate patient interaction across several core responsibilities.
Perform Advanced Diagnostic Imaging
MRI technologists operate sophisticated scanners that utilize strong magnetic fields and radio waves, rather than radiation, to produce detailed cross-sectional images of the body. They must:
- Position patients correctly.
- Select the right imaging protocols.
- Adjust scan parameters to capture the clearest possible images for the radiologist to interpret.
Prioritize Patient Safety and MRI Safety Protocols
Because MRI uses powerful magnets, safety is a constant priority. Technologists screen patients for implants, metal objects and other contraindications before every scan, and they enforce strict protocols to keep the magnet room safe. Many patients feel anxious or claustrophobic, so technologists also reassure them and explain what to expect during the procedure.
Collaborate With Physicians and Healthcare Teams
While a radiologist reviews and interprets the results, the technologist is responsible for producing the best possible images. According to the American Registry of Radiologic Technologists (ARRT), MRI techs work directly with radiologists and serve as an integral part of each patient's medical team when it comes to communicating findings and coordinating care.
Work Across a Variety of Healthcare Settings
MRI technologists are needed in a range of environments, which presents flexibility to find a setting that fits your goals. Per the U.S. Bureau of Labor Statistics (BLS), they work in:
- Hospitals
- Outpatient imaging centers
- Physicians' offices
- Specialty clinics
Why Choose a Career in MRI Technology?
Several factors make MRI technology an appealing and stable career choice.
Strong Job Growth and Demand
For one, the field is expanding. The BLS outlook projects that employment of MRI techs specifically will grow 7% from 2024 to 2034 — with roughly 15,400 openings per year on average across the occupation for radiologic and MRI technologists. This is driven by an aging population and the rising prevalence of chronic disease that, in turn, elevate demand for diagnostic imaging.
Competitive Salary Potential
MRI technology is among the higher-paying allied health careers. According to the BLS, MRI technologists earned a median annual wage of $88,180 in May 2024, with the top earners making over $121,000. Pay varies by geography, experience and specialization.

What Are the Requirements for How to Become an MRI Technologist?
Becoming an MRI tech generally follows a clear sequence of education, certification and specialization.
Start With a Foundation in Radiologic Technology
Most MRI technologists begin with formal education in radiologic technology, typically an associate degree from an accredited program. This foundation covers:
- Anatomy
- Patient care
- Imaging physics
- The clinical skills needed to work safely in a medical imaging environment
Earn ARRT(R) Certification
After completing an accredited program, graduates are eligible to sit for the ARRT certification exam in radiography, earning the R.T.(R) credential. This is the standard entry credential for the profession as well as the most common foundation for specializing later.
Pursue an MRI Specialty Credential
To specialize, technologists earn the ARRT MRI credential through one of two paths:
- The postprimary pathway is for those already ARRT-certified in a supporting category who want to add MRI.
- The primary pathway is for those completing an ARRT-approved MRI program and holding at least an associate degree.
Both require meeting education, ethics and examination requirements.

What Will You Study in MRI Coursework?
MRI coursework encompasses advanced science alongside practical, supervised training.
Advanced Cross-Sectional Anatomy
Because MRI produces detailed sectional images, students study cross-sectional anatomy in depth. They learn to recognize structures and abnormalities across multiple imaging planes.
Principles of Magnetic Resonance Imaging
Coursework covers the physics behind MRI, including how magnetic fields and radio waves generate images, along with image production, equipment and quality control.
Advanced MRI Techniques and Applications
Students move into specialized techniques and clinical applications — learning the protocols used to image different parts of the body and a range of conditions.
Clinical Externship and Hands-On Experience
Classroom learning is paired with supervised clinical experience, where students perform MRI procedures under the guidance of credentialed technologists and document the competencies required for certification.
